Bible Reading for Today

Proverbs 20

Bible Verse for Today

“Even a child makes himself known by his acts, by whether his conduct is pure and upright.”

Proverbs 20:11

Devotion for Today

Personal Wisdom

“What are you known for?” That’s the note I have written in my Bible next to this verse in Proverbs.

We are all known for something. It’s like those meme’s that go around Facebook from time to time that say something like, “Finish this sentence: Everyone who knows me, knows I love _________.” I want the answer to that question to be Jesus. But the truth is that we are all known for a lot of things. You might be well known for your affection for cows, your love of pumpkin spice, or even your work ethic. But do others know you are a Christian?

John 13:35 says, “By this all people will know that you are my disciples, if you have love for one another.” Are you known for your love for others? Or even your love for Jesus? I know I didn’t use to be. I was caught up in various things that I loved. I was known for working at Pizza Hut, being a wife, and I’m sure there were other things I was known for as well. Those aren’t bad things to be known for, but Jesus wasn’t even on my list even though I considered myself a Christian. So that’s where we are today, are you known for your love for Jesus? How can you cultivate your life so that it points others to Christ?
